Các nhà nghiên cứu phát triển phần cứng tăng tốc độ truyền thông trong các lõi của CPU

Các nhà nghiên cứu của Trường đại học bang Bắc Carolina ( NC State ) đã cộng tác với Intel để tìm ra phương pháp tăng tốc độ truyền thông giữa các lõi trong bộ vi xử lí  .

 

Những bộ vi xử lí  dùng trong PC và thiết bị mobile ngày nay có rất nhiều lõi làm việc cùng với nhau để giải quyết những công việc . Hiện tại điều này đạt được do những mệnh lệnh phần mềm gửi và nhận giữa các lõi . Với phương pháp này sẽ mất thời gian sẽ khiến cho hiệu suất làm việc tổng thể của chip bị giảm đi .

Các nhà nghiên cứu tại NC State biết rằng họ có thể làm việc được tốt hơn . Với sự hỗ trợ từ Intel , họ đã tạo ra thiết kế chip mới thay thế phần mềm trung gian đã nói trên bằng giải pháp phần cứng tích hợp để tăng tốc độ truyền thông giữa các lõi .

Yan Solihin , giáo sư khoa Kỹ sư máy tính và Điện tử tại NC State và là đồng tác giá nghiên cứu , đã gọi đề xuất của mình là CAF (communication acceleration framework) lõi-tới-lõi . Theo giáo sư , CAF đã cải thiện hiệu suất truyền thông gấp tới 12 lần và điều đó đã khiến cho thời gian thực hiện công việc nhanh ít nhất gấp hai lần .

Thiết kế của CAF là thiết bị nhỏ đính kèm với bộ vi xử lí  có tên gọi QMD (queue management device) được thêm vào để giữ lại vết những yêu cầu trao đổi thông tin giữa các lõi , có thể thực hiện những chức năng tính toán đơn giản . Bởi vì thế nó có thể tăng tốc một số hàm tính toán cơ bản thêm tới 15% .

Solihin nói rằng đội ngũ nghiên cứu của mình đang nghiên cứu thiết bị On-Chip khác để có thể tăng tốc độ tính toán đa lõi . Công việc của họ sẽ được giới thiệu trong bản báo cáo có tên “CAF: Core to Core Communication Acceleration Framework” tại Hội nghị hàng năm lần thứ 25 , “Parallel Architectures and Compilation Techniques” diễn ra ở Israel hôm 11/9 tới .